[Bioavailability of carotenoids].

M Ia Shashkina1, P N Shashkin, A V Sergeev

  • 1Blokhin Cancer Research Centre, Russian Academy of Medical Sciences, Moscow.

Voprosy Meditsinskoi Khimii
|June 23, 1999
PubMed
Summary

This review examines how the body absorbs carotenoids, influenced by internal and external factors. Understanding carotenoid uptake mechanisms can improve drug formulations, dietary supplements, and personalized nutrition plans.

Area of Science:

  • Biochemistry
  • Human Physiology
  • Nutrition Science

Context:

  • Carotenoids are vital pigments with diverse biological roles.
  • Understanding carotenoid assimilation is crucial for human health.
  • Environmental and physiological factors influence carotenoid bioavailability.

Purpose:

  • To review the mechanisms of carotenoid assimilation in living organisms.
  • To analyze the impact of environmental and internal factors on carotenoid uptake.
  • To provide a foundation for optimizing carotenoid-based interventions.

Summary:

  • This review details the gradual assimilation process of carotenoids within the organism.
  • It explores the temporal dynamics and influencing factors of carotenoid absorption.
  • Key mechanisms governing carotenoid uptake are elucidated.

Impact:

  • Informs the development of improved carotenoid-based pharmaceuticals and nutraceuticals.
  • Enables the creation of evidence-based dietary guidelines and recommendations.
  • Facilitates personalized dosage regimens for various population groups.
